Why the Neighborhood Pack is its own game
Organic rankings and Neighborhood Pack positions overlap, however they are not the exact same race. The Regional Pack responds to a various mix of signals: proximity, importance, and prestige. Distance is what it sounds like, the somewhat unfair tiebreaker you can not transform. Significance is where most businesses go wrong, since they attempt to rank for "plumbing Boston" while their account states "home solutions" and their web site conceals the word "pipes" behind brand fluff. Importance is the mix of authority signals, from evaluations to web links to push points out. When you accept this design, your concerns shift. You quit chasing after wide nationwide web links and start earning citations from the Dorchester Reporter.
Boston has 3 traits that turn the board. First, density. You could share an edge with three rivals, so closeness brings much less weight and tie-breaking is up to relevance and importance. Second, area identification. Look behavior consists of micro-local modifiers like "Fort Factor yoga" or "JP brunch," and the algorithm has actually found out to map those. Third, multi-location saturation. Chains and franchises blanket the area, and they bring process. Independent services can win, yet they have to be more deliberate.
The foundation: a totally packed Google Service Profile
Too many profiles look total at a glimpse yet leave half the areas extra. A profile needs to review like a small site. I such as to believe in layers, since each layer earns depend on with both individuals and the algorithm.
Name, groups, hours, address, phone, website. These fundamentals should match your real-world existence, not a marketing dream. Boston has a great deal of collection numbers and co-working addresses. If you utilize a virtual workplace, you are requesting suspensions. Ground fact issues. Classifications are entitled to focus beyond the key field. A South End vet center that includes "Emergency situation vet service" as an additional group and appropriately sets up hours for after-hours triage will certainly turn up for urgent searches even if the clinic is technically closed.
Services and products. Load these out with the very same care you put into your site navigation. A roof covering business that lists "flat roofing system repair," "EPDM roof covering," and "snow removal" surface areas for winter season searches that common "roof covering services" misses. For retail, listing your crucial line of product. We viewed a South Boston liquor store include "Japanese whisky," "all-natural wine," and "neighborhood craft beer," after that saw "near me" perceptions climb 15 to 20 percent over 2 months, especially on Friday afternoons.
Attributes. These seem trivial up until they are not. Wheelchair access, veteran-owned, women-led, pet-friendly, totally free Wi-Fi. Qualities assist you match long-tail queries and they connect values to your consumers. A Financial Area cafe that toggled "excellent for remote job" did not leapfrog competitors by itself, yet it started appearing for "meeting spot near me" and similar queries.
Photos and video clips. Every single time we perform a before-and-after on image libraries, engagement actions. Go for 30 to 50 pictures minimal, with a rhythm of fresh uploads. Consist of exterior shots from road degree so site visitors can acknowledge the exterior when they tip off the Red Line. Video clip trips assist individuals comprehend design, especially for showrooms in older buildings with odd entries. Geotagging files is not a ranking rip off, but accurate graph minimizes bounce and boosts instructions demands, both of which associate with much better visibility.
Posts. Deal with Messages like a bulletin board system. Short, useful, timely. If you host classes, release class calendars with days and times. If you run seasonal promotions, post them with clear CTAs. We saw a Cambridge yoga exercise workshop double its top quality exploration impressions during January by publishing weekly "New to yoga exercise" articles that linked to a $29 intro offer. The articles really did not rate on their very own, they signaled a living business and gave searchers factors to tap.
Q&& A. Seed FAQs that real customers ask. Do not produce a phony conversation, yet address the leading 5 challenges that turn up at the front workdesk. Parking in the North End, distribution cutoff times during a snow storm, on-site quotes in high-rises, insurance forms for physical treatment. This minimizes friction and drives calls from the ideal prospects.
The information hygiene nobody wishes to do
Local citations still matter. Not in the volume-obsessed means people spoke about them in 2015, however in the uniformity feeling. The algorithm tries to integrate identification across the internet. If you moved from Somerville to Medford and your Yelp, Apple Maps, and the Better Business Bureau still show the old address, you are informing Google you may not be who you state you are.
Audit the huge four: Google, Apple, Bing, Yelp. Then hit industry-specific directory sites that your consumers actually make use of. In Boston, that can include the Chamber of Business, local business associations, and community sites like Universal Hub when they run a directory site. Stay clear of the automatic spree that sprays your information across junk collectors. If you involve a SEO Company Near Me that promises hundreds of citations in a week, reviewed the small print. Frequently you inherit a clean-up project.
Phones and tracking numbers create a common catch. If you rely upon call monitoring, usage dynamic number insertion on your site and set a main number in your Google Business Profile that never ever adjustments. Store the tracking numbers in the account's extra phone areas. That way you preserve NAP uniformity while still attributing calls.
On-page job that sustains neighborhood intent
You can not bank on your account alone. The Neighborhood Load algorithm reads your site to verify importance. When we enter a project as component of SEO seeking advice from solutions, the web site job typically lugs the heaviest lift.
Location web pages. Organizations with solution locations require pages that explain real protection, not a list of towns. A page for "Plumbing technician in Jamaica Level" ought to reference triple-deckers, radiator conversions, and winter season pipeline ruptureds, with a number of before-and-after images from Stony Brook or Hyde Square. Mentioning roads and spots is not a hack, it reveals you offer the neighborhood. These pages have to fill fast and supply a clear course to get in touch with, otherwise they end up being thin content.
Service pages. Compose for the jobs that pay your expenses. If roof replacement brings profit yet leak patches drive leads, offer both their due. Integrate signs and symptoms, not just attributes: "water discolorations on third-floor ceilings on windy days" is the sort of phrase a Southie house owner kinds when a nor'easter reveals a problem.
Schema markup. Use LocalBusiness schema with hours, areaServed, and sameAs links that verify your identification. For multi-location brands, add Organization schema on the primary website and LocalBusiness on each location web page. Increase products or services when pertinent. Schema will certainly not lug you to the three-pack alone, but it offers clarity at scale.
Internal web links. If the homepage is a hectic center, overview individuals into a tree that mirrors how they browse. From "Kitchen makeover Boston," web link to "Back Bay brownstone kitchen area remodels" and "South End condo kitchen area codes." Support message must be descriptive without spamming. Your goal is to aid site visitors self-select, and Google complies with that trail.
Core internet vitals. Mobile experience matters much more for local than almost any kind of other segment. Walk around Fenway on video game day and attempt to fill a hefty web page on a congested network. If your tap targets are tiny and your forms ask for 8 fields, you shed that lead. Press photos, trim scripts, and test on a 4G connection, not office Wi-Fi.
Reviews as the heart beat of neighborhood prominence
If you run in Boston, you contend versus opinionated customers that are not reluctant about comments. The review tally is not the only metric that relocates the needle. Recency, rate, and material quality influence conversion and, over time, visibility.
Build a system. Ask at the best minute, make it easy, and never ever incentivize with discounts. The toughest programs accumulate reviews at point of service with a shortlink and a clear ask. Field groups need to have the web link saved in their phone. For controlled industries such as healthcare or legal, conformity restricts demands, so you count more on passive invitations and third-party systems that fit governing guidelines.
Respond with compound. A one-line "Thanks for your business" wastes a possibility. If a review discusses a specific professional or menu product, recommendation it. If there's a complaint regarding car park near TD Garden on video game nights, be honest about constraints, after that offer choices. The objective is not to win the disagreement. It is to show the following viewers that you SEO Agency care and that you have functional control.
Mine reviews for key phrases you didn't think to target. Customers define their issues in their own words. We as soon as noticed duplicated points out of "cool draft by windows" in evaluations for a window installer near Arlington and Medford. We constructed a page around winter drafts, changed advertisement copy, and saw calls spike after the very first frost.
Be platform-savvy. Google testimonials are the primary money, yet Yelp carries weight in Boston's dining scene and feeds Apple Maps. Particular niche systems like Healthgrades or Avvo matter for certain verticals. Do not press every client to every platform. Aim for a well balanced footprint that reflects real usage.

The function of links in a local-first strategy
You do not require 500 links to defeat the competitors in the Regional Load. You require the ideal 20 to 50. Local news mentions, chamber subscription accounts, sponsorship web pages with meaningful context, and cooperations with Boston establishments lug out of proportion weight.
Think geographically and culturally. A back links from a respected neighborhood blog site that covers Roslindale can outperform a common national directory. Co-create web content with partners. A South End indoor designer joined a historical preservation team to release a guide on decorative moldings in brownstones. The item gained a handful of citations from design forums and neighborhood magazines, and query high quality boosted overnight.
PR still functions, but keep it based. If you open up a 2nd location, pitch the story to Patch and the World's regional section. Share specifics: regional hiring, hours that fit change employees, available layout. These tales generate branded search, which after that raises discovery.
Tracking what issues without drowning in dashboards
Local search engine optimization can create a blizzard of metrics. The trick is to measure a handful that map to organization outcomes and to complement them with area feedback.
Watch direction demands, calls, site clicks, and messaging from your Google Company Profile, however consider the pattern by postal code. If calls climb general yet reduce in Allston, you might have a rival gaining ground there. For internet sites, section natural web traffic by place web page and correlate with type entries and call recordings. Take note of call top quality before commemorating a spike; a ruptured of "do you sell paint" contacts us to a floor covering shop is a misalignment problem.
Rank tracking has value if you mirror genuine problems. Usage geo-grids moderately and for top priority keyword phrases. A 9x9 grid throughout Sign Hill for "emergency situation plumbing" can inform you where you are weak at the edge of your solution radius. Do not chase after pixels across every key phrase. Rather, tie ranking areas to lead quantity and revenue.
Tie procedures to advertising and marketing signals. Winter months tornados, marathon day road closures, and university move-in weeks all transform search behavior. Develop playbooks. When a nor'easter techniques, update hours, release a blog post with solution support, and stage teams. When the Red Sox have a home video game, restaurants near Kenmore ought to readjust their Blog posts to capture pregame and postgame website traffic. These are little relocations that transform visibility right into revenue.

Handling side instances Boston businesses commonly face
Virtual solution areas: Lawyers, therapists, and experts that satisfy clients by visit only can still rank, yet the margins are slim. Hide your address in Google Business Profile if you do not serve clients at your location, after that expand your solution area cautiously. Lean on content, testimonials, and neighborhood web links to construct prominence. Accept that you will certainly not own "near me" inquiries throughout the city without physical presence.
Suspensions: Google can and does suspend profiles after edit sprees or when rivals report you. Keep a folder with proof of company, consisting of utility costs, lease agreements, store front photos, and license numbers. Respond swiftly and skillfully. Most reinstatements fix in 1 to 3 weeks if your business is legitimate.
Seasonality and student churn: September brings an influx of trainees, which shifts demand for solutions like relocating, storage space, made use of furnishings, and fast home solutions. March and April expose winter damage. Build micro-campaigns and Messages around these cycles. We enjoyed a handyman solution in Allston release a "move-out spot and paint" guide each May, which drove a burst of form fills up trusted SEO agency and repeat business in August.
Competitors with suspicious techniques: You will certainly see keyword-stuffed names on Google Company Profile and fake testimonials. Report them with evidence rather than mirror their actions. We have actually filed lots of edit ideas for name spam in Boston, and lots of obtain approved. When they do not, proceed. Spend energy where you have control.
